Anushka Sharma, Farhan Akhtar and others urge people to stand up against domestic violence amid lockdown

Apr 20, 2020 1:26 PM, 6 news, a view

In a one-minute video clip titled Lockdown On Domestic Violence, Anushka Sharma, Karan Johar, Vidya Balan, Madhuri Dixit and others urged fans to take a firm stand against domestic violence.
